Sharat (Autumn) Soy-Free Menu Ideas

1. Vegetable Khichuri: A nutritious and flavorful dish made with rice, lentils, and a variety of seasonal vegetables like carrots, peas, and beans. It is seasoned with spices and served with a side of yogurt.

2. Pumpkin Soup with Whole Wheat Bread: A comforting and creamy soup made with locally grown pumpkins, onions, and garlic. Served with whole wheat bread for a wholesome meal.

3. Spinach and Potato Curry with Rice: A delicious curry made with fresh spinach, potatoes, tomatoes, and aromatic spices. Served with steamed rice for a balanced and satisfying meal.

4. Mixed Vegetable Stir-Fry with Quinoa: A colorful stir-fry dish made with a mix of seasonal vegetables like bell peppers, cauliflower, and green beans. Served with protein-rich quinoa for a complete meal.

5. Egg Fried Rice with Mixed Vegetables: A simple and nutritious dish made with scrambled eggs, rice, and a medley of seasonal vegetables like carrots, peas, and corn. Packed with protein and vitamins.

6. Chicken and Vegetable Stew with Roti: A hearty stew made with tender chicken, seasonal vegetables, and fragrant spices. Served with homemade whole wheat roti for a wholesome and filling meal.

7. Sweet Potato and Lentil Curry with Chapati: A flavorful curry made with sweet potatoes, lentils, and a blend of aromatic spices. Served with chapati, a traditional flatbread, for a nutritious and satisfying meal.

8. Fish Curry with Steamed Vegetables and Rice: A traditional Bengali fish curry made with locally caught fish, tomatoes, and spices. Served with a side of steamed vegetables and rice for a balanced meal.

9. Beetroot and Carrot Salad with Grilled Chicken: A refreshing salad made with grated beetroot, carrots, and a tangy dressing. Served with grilled chicken for added protein and flavor.

10. Mixed Vegetable Pulao with Raita: A fragrant rice dish cooked with a variety of seasonal vegetables like cauliflower, carrots, and peas. Served with raita, a yogurt-based side dish, for a cooling and nutritious meal.

11. Mung Bean Soup with Vegetable Paratha: A nourishing soup made with mung beans, seasonal vegetables, and spices. Served with vegetable paratha, a stuffed flatbread, for a wholesome and satisfying meal.

12. Tomato and Capsicum Pasta with Grilled Fish: A kid-friendly pasta dish made with fresh tomatoes, capsicum, and whole wheat pasta. Served with grilled fish for added protein and omega-3 fatty acids.

13. Cabbage and Carrot Stir-Fry with Brown Rice: A simple and nutritious stir-fry made with shredded cabbage, carrots, and garlic. Served with fiber-rich brown rice for a healthy and filling meal.

14. Chicken and Vegetable Biryani: A flavorful and aromatic rice dish cooked with chicken, seasonal vegetables, and a blend of spices. Served with raita for a complete and satisfying meal.

15. Lentil Soup with Vegetable Cutlets: A hearty lentil soup made with locally available lentils, vegetables, and spices. Served with vegetable cutlets for a balanced and protein-packed meal.

These meal ideas provide a variety of options using commonly available seasonal ingredients in Bangladesh during the autumn season. They are designed to be healthy, cost-effective, and suitable for 3-5 year-old children at kindergarten
